Capacitor Simple Circuit. Capacitors are simple passive device that can store an electrical charge on their plates when connected to a voltage source. When you turn on the power, an electric charge gradually builds up on the plates. You can charge a capacitor simply by wiring it up into an electric circuit. The capacitor will block out low frequencies, while the inductor blocks out high frequencies. In this introduction to capacitors tutorial, we will see that capacitors are passive electronic components consisting of two or more pieces of conducting material separated by an insulating material. Working principle of a capacitor: Series circuit and parallel circuit. A capacitor is defined as a device with two parallel plates separated by a dielectric, used to store electrical energy. Alternating current in a simple capacitive circuit is equal to the voltage (in volts) divided by the capacitive reactance (in ohms), just as either alternating or direct current in a simple resistive.
